Updating data from one table to another in sql server

For more information about compression, see Data Compression. OFF Table locks are applied for the duration of the index operation. In order to be used, hidden columns must be explicitly included in all queries that directly reference the temporal table. So when might you need to copy data from one table to another? I like to materialize all of the columns to disk, rather than rely on computed columns, since the table becomes read-only after initial population. Specifies whether the Database Engine tracks which change tracked columns were updated. One way is to use a subquery: The locking strategy during an alter column online operation follows the same locking pattern used for online index build. This is the default setting. This operation incurs data transfer costs, and it can't be canceled.

For more info, see Data Transfers Pricing Details. How this can be done? Online alter column does not support altering more than one column concurrently. Disabling Stretch Database for a table When you disable Stretch for a table, you have two options for the remote data that has already been migrated to Azure. Note In this context, default is not a keyword. There are certain things that largely matters. These include user-defined type variables and user-defined functions. This operation incurs data transfer costs, and it can't be canceled. This is because the existing rows in the table are not updated during the operation; instead, the default value is stored only in the metadata of the table and the value is looked up as needed in queries that access these rows. Online alter column does not support altering to an XML data type that has a schema collection different than the current schema collection. Reassigns all data in one partition of a partitioned table to an existing non-partitioned table. The default value stored in metadata is moved to an existing row when the row is updated even if the actual column is not specified in the UPDATE statement , or if the table or clustered index is rebuilt. Only one index at a time can be dropped. Q27 What do you know about the stored procedure? They are generally preferred when it comes to defining or changing the structure of a specific database in the shortest possible times due to security and other concerns. This has always been a complicated problem; the rules for calculating the exact date are so convoluted , I suspect most people can only mark those dates where they have physical calendars they can look at to confirm. Now these pre-calculated values can help to derive all of the other materialized columns you might want in your calendar table. These are several good things about them. It is defined as an INT not because that is my preference I would always store this as a DATE , but because that seems to be the preference of most data warehousing professionals. Sharing them here will hopefully prevent you from re-inventing any wheels when populating your own tables. So I'm going to do a lot of those calculations during the initial population of the temp table: This data consistency check ensures that existing records do not overlap. Specifies the Windows-compatible FileTable directory name. An offline index operation that creates, rebuilds, or drops a clustered index, or rebuilds or drops a nonclustered index, acquires a Schema modification Sch-M lock on the table. Can only be used with a FileTable. Since I am in the United States, I'm going to deal with statutory holidays here; of course, if you live in another country, you'll need to use different logic here. However, removing or changing a column that participates in any schema-bound view is not allowed.

